From e04562cdc8849cd6bdf74b9bc3a78171afbf2fae Mon Sep 17 00:00:00 2001 From: Freeplay Date: Tue, 23 May 2023 13:56:29 -0400 Subject: [PATCH 1/4] Fix tabs not transitioning on first click --- packages/client/src/components/global/MkPageHeader.vue |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/packages/client/src/components/global/MkPageHeader.vue b/packages/client/src/components/global/MkPageHeader.vue index 1892ec0c0..944c6140a 100644 --- a/packages/client/src/components/global/MkPageHeader.vue +++ b/packages/client/src/components/global/MkPageHeader.vue @@ -541,7 +541,7 @@ onUnmounted(() => { opacity: 0.7; overflow: hidden; transition: color 0.2s, opacity 0.2s, width 0.2s, min-width 0.2s; - --width: max-content; + --width: 38px; &:hover { opacity: 1; From cab146fb9684d543982f5de940fe5ad8bad8373f Mon Sep 17 00:00:00 2001 From: Freeplay Date: Tue, 23 May 2023 20:30:55 -0400 Subject: [PATCH 2/4] Fix z-index, better clipping in notes --- packages/client/src/components/MkMention.vue | 22 +++++---- packages/client/src/components/MkNote.vue | 31 ++++++++++++- .../client/src/components/MkNoteDetailed.vue | 1 + packages/client/src/components/MkNoteSub.vue | 46 +++++++++++++++++-- .../client/src/components/MkRenoteButton.vue | 17 +------ .../client/src/components/MkStarButton.vue | 11 +---- .../src/components/MkStarButtonNoEmoji.vue | 15 +----- .../src/components/MkSubNoteContent.vue | 4 ++ 8 files changed, 93 insertions(+), 54 deletions(-) diff --git a/packages/client/src/components/MkMention.vue b/packages/client/src/components/MkMention.vue index 4a336c941..af982fbbc 100644 --- a/packages/client/src/components/MkMention.vue +++ b/packages/client/src/components/MkMention.vue @@ -5,7 +5,6 @@ class="akbvjaqn" :class="{ isMe }" :to="url" - :style="{ background: bgCss }" @click.stop > @@ -37,7 +36,6 @@ diff --git a/packages/client/src/components/MkStarButton.vue b/packages/client/src/components/MkStarButton.vue index a8bf79c40..ecfbf2e73 100644 --- a/packages/client/src/components/MkStarButton.vue +++ b/packages/client/src/components/MkStarButton.vue @@ -1,7 +1,7 @@